1. Understanding Market Research: The Foundation of Successful Ventures
Market research serves as the cornerstone of any successful venture, providing essential insights that inform decision-making and strategy development. It involves the systematic gathering, analysis, and interpretation of data related to a market, including information about consumers, competitors, and the overall industry landscape. By understanding market dynamics, entrepreneurs can identify opportunities, anticipate challenges, and adjust their business models accordingly.
One of the primary benefits of market research is its ability to illuminate customer needs and preferences. By analyzing demographic data, purchasing behaviors, and feedback from potential customers, entrepreneurs can tailor their products or services to better meet the demands of their target audience. This customer-centric approach not only enhances the likelihood of a successful launch but also fosters long-term loyalty.
Moreover, market research helps in assessing the competitive landscape. By examining the strengths and weaknesses of existing players, new ventures can pinpoint gaps in the market, differentiate themselves, and develop unique selling propositions. This strategic positioning is vital for attracting customers and securing a foothold in a crowded marketplace.
Additionally, market research minimizes risks associated with launching a new venture. By understanding market trends and economic factors, entrepreneurs can make informed predictions about future demand and adjust their strategies to mitigate potential setbacks. This foresight enables them to allocate resources more effectively, ensuring that their investment yields a positive return.
In summary, market research is not merely a preliminary step; it is an ongoing process that underpins the entire journey of a new venture. By committing to thorough research, entrepreneurs can build a solid foundation for their business, leading to informed decisions, enhanced customer satisfaction, and increased chances of success.
2. Identifying Target Audiences: Unlocking Customer Insights Through Research
Identifying target audiences is a crucial aspect of market research that enables entrepreneurs to unlock valuable customer insights. Understanding who potential customers are, what they need, and how they behave allows businesses to tailor their offerings effectively, increasing the likelihood of a successful launch.
Market research techniques such as surveys, interviews, and focus groups provide qualitative and quantitative data that reveal demographic information, preferences, and pain points. This data helps in segmenting the market into distinct groups based on criteria such as age, gender, location, and buying habits. By identifying specific target segments, entrepreneurs can create more personalized marketing strategies and product features that resonate with these audiences.
Furthermore, market research uncovers customer motivations and aspirations, which are essential for crafting compelling value propositions. For instance, understanding what drives a target audience to make a purchase—be it price, quality, or brand loyalty—enables businesses to align their messaging and positioning accordingly. Additionally, insights gathered from research can inform product development, ensuring that features and benefits meet the actual needs of the target market.
In summary, effectively identifying target audiences through market research not only enhances the alignment of products with consumer expectations but also provides a roadmap for strategic marketing efforts. This foundational step lays the groundwork for building lasting customer relationships and achieving long-term business success.
3. Mitigating Risks: How Market Research Informs Strategic Decision-Making
Market research plays a pivotal role in mitigating risks associated with launching a new venture by equipping entrepreneurs with critical insights that inform strategic decision-making. Understanding the target market, including customer preferences, behaviors, and needs, allows businesses to tailor their offerings effectively. This knowledge helps in identifying potential gaps in the market and assessing competitive dynamics, thereby reducing the likelihood of missteps that could lead to financial loss.
Additionally, market research enables entrepreneurs to anticipate market trends and shifts that may impact their venture. By analyzing industry reports, consumer feedback, and emerging technologies, businesses can adapt their strategies proactively, ensuring they remain relevant and competitive. This foresight can significantly decrease the risks associated with product development and marketing initiatives.
Furthermore, thorough market research aids in testing ideas and concepts before full-scale implementation. Techniques such as surveys, focus groups, and pilot programs provide valuable feedback, allowing entrepreneurs to refine their products or services and optimize their market entry strategies. By validating their assumptions and making data-driven decisions, businesses can minimize uncertainties and increase their chances of success in a competitive landscape. Overall, effective market research is an indispensable tool for navigating the complexities of launching a new venture, ultimately leading to more informed choices and reduced risks.
